In a changing world, violent fae encroachment on shifter land makes the impossible necessary—an alliance between predator and prey.

Nicca Baron, wolf beta, balks when assigned to a mission led by Evan Grant, the rat alpha. In different circumstances, he’d be dinner, or so her wolf keeps reminding her. But Evan proves to be a perceptive leader, a skilled fighter, and irresistible to her lonely heart.

To rule the rats, you must rule the pack. Evan is a master at managing groups—until he finds himself commanding large shifters who challenge his authority at every turn. The only bright light is calm, capable Nicca. Her succulent curves offer the perfect place for a rat to nestle.

In each other’s arms, Nicca and Evan discover new perspectives in an off-kilter world. But a wolf cannot mate with a rat, no matter the strength of the human attraction.
